Overview

Postcode EX14 9RB is located in a rural hamlet, within the Dunkeswell & Otterhead ward of East Devon in the South West region, and forms part of the Dunkeswell, Upottery & Stockland area. It has average de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 20.4 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 76% below the South West average of 85 per 1,000. The average income per household in Dunkeswell, Upottery & Stockland is £47,613 per year. The nearest station is Honiton, about 6.5 miles away. There are 1 primary and no secondary schools in the area.

Property prices in Dunkeswell & Otterhead

Median price£280,000
Price per sq ft£345
Sales (last 12 months)45
Typical range (middle 50%)£220K – £480K

Based on 45 recent sales, the median property price is £280,000 (about £345 per square foot) in Dunkeswell & Otterhead area, with individual transactions ranging from £150,000 up to £1,350,000.
